Adding parallelism to sequential programs – a combined method

I tiakina i:
Ngā taipitopito rārangi puna kōrero
I whakaputaina i:International Journal of Electronics and Telecommunications vol. 70, no. 1 (2024), p. 135
Kaituhi matua: Daszczuk, Wiktor B
Ētahi atu kaituhi: Czejdo, Denny B, Grześkowiak, Wociech
I whakaputaina:
Polish Academy of Sciences
Ngā marau:
Urunga tuihono:Citation/Abstract
Full Text - PDF
Ngā Tūtohu: Tāpirihia he Tūtohu
Kāore He Tūtohu, Me noho koe te mea tuatahi ki te tūtohu i tēnei pūkete!
Whakaahuatanga
Whakarāpopotonga:The article outlines a contemporary method for creating software for multi-processor computers. It describes the identification of parallelizable sequential code structures. Three structures were found and then carefully examined. The algorithms used to determine whether or not certain parts of code may be parallelized result from static analysis. The techniques demonstrate how, if possible, existing sequential structures might be transformed into parallel-running programs. A dynamic evaluation is also a part of our process, and it can be used to assess the efficiency of the parallel programs that are developed. As a tool for sequential programs, the algorithms have been implemented in C#. All proposed methods were discussed using a common benchmark.
ISSN:2081-8491
2300-1933
0035-9386
0867-6747
DOI:10.24425/ijet.2024.149523
Puna:Advanced Technologies & Aerospace Database